guanidinoacetate : A monocarboxylic acid anion that is the conjugate base of guanidinoacetic acid, obtained by deprotonation of the carboxy group.
guanidinoacetic acid : The N-amidino derivative of glycine.
Kidney Diseases: Pathological processes of the KIDNEY or its component tissues.
